  2. Peristylus holochila -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Peristylus_holochila

    It is endemic to Hawaii. It is a federally listed endangered species of the United States. When the orchid was added to the Endangered Species List in 1996 there were fewer than 35 individuals remaining, divided amongst small populations located on the islands of Kauai , Maui , and Molokai .   4. Anoectochilus sandvicensis -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Anoectochilus_sandvicensis

    Anoectochilus sandvicensis, also called Hawaii jewel-orchid, is a species of plant in the family Orchidaceae. It is endemic to Hawaii. [2] It is threatened by habitat loss. [1] It is found in the Haleakala National Park. [3] It grows in dense, dark, and continuously saturated forest. [4]
